The clarity of sound from MACH 60 boasts open highs and great depths in the mids and lows; a nice, balanced soundstage for all to enjoy. The MACH 60 features a proprietary six-driver system with dual lows, dual mids, and dual highs and a 3-way passive crossover.

6 Balanced-Armature Drivers
Westone Audio’s proprietary balanced-armature drivers provide enhanced sonic detail and frequency range that extends well beyond other in-ear solutions. MACH 60 is equipped with a 3-way, six-driver system with dual lows, dual mids, and dual highs

Linum/Estron SUPERBaX™ CABLE
The SuperBaX was developed to meet the needs of audiophiles in their constant pursuit of the perfect audio setup. With low 0.75 Ohms resistance, the SuperBaX offers pure sound reproduction with a light cable.

I would not call myself an audiophile, more of a fussy listener. I have tried cheaper iem's but never found a pair I liked the sound of - treble usually far too harsh for me. These were reduced in price so I thought I'd give them a try and I am very glad I did, they sound brilliant and are very lightweight and comfortable. I was surprised how thin the cable was but it hasn't broken so far and I am terrible for tangling wires so the jury might be out on that but the cable is replaceable so I don't think that's worth knocking a star off for as they do sound absolutely terrific..
The only other issue I had is that because they are iem's I had a hard job getting the right level for the volume. That's actually a problem with my phone because it has too few volume increments for my liking as I listen at fairly low volumes. To solve this I use these with my hip dac 2 and now I can get beautiful sound at the right volume level for me. To my ears the dac didn't actually make any difference to the sound quality so it's not like you need one with these I don't think but as a volume control it's perfect.
Long story short, I would heartily recommend them. Folk and acoustic music sounds particularly great and there is absolutely no sibilance or harsh treble. Happy days.
